Have bitten the bullet and made my first ever Christmas cake last week. It's the Delia classic one. I soaked the fruit in more brandy than Delia said, and left it for 2 days to try and get really soaked in. Have just taken the cake out (stored as per instructions) to feed it with more brandy, and it feels as hard as a brick.

Is this normal? Will it moisten up with more feeding every week?

Have made it very early to give myself time to make another in case I need to!

Any help gratefully received.

Is it dry or just solid and heavy?

They usually do feel heavy and solid, so I would persevere and only be concerned if it seemed dry. From what I remember Delia's cake is very dense. I would keep feeding. Mine usually starts to actually leak booze I feed it so much.
